Hello! I am a Trauma-informed therapist committed to providing individualized care that honors each client’s unique experiences, values, and needs. My clinical approach is grounded in trauma informed/evidence-based practices and a deep understanding of the complex ways in which trauma, identity, culture, and environment influence mental health. I work from a person-centered framework, meeting clients where they are in their journey. I strive to foster a therapeutic environment that is safe, inclusive, and nonjudgmental—where clients feel heard, validated, and supported in the process of change. Please call, I would love to meet you! I specialize in working with individuals, children, and aging population with anxiety, depression, personality and relationship issues. I have extensive experience supporting clients with a history of emotional, psychological, and relational trauma, as well as those managing chronic stress, grief, and self-esteem concerns.
